A Henry County jury convicted Chiqueta Denise Turner of armed robbery OCGA § 16-8-411 and kidnapping OCGA § 16-5-40.2 She was sentenced to confinement for ten years on both counts. On appeal, Turner challenges the sufficiency of the evidence at trial, the impeachment of a defense witness upon the admission of three prior convictions for crimes involving moral turpitude,3 the validity of her in-court identification, and the jury charge as to multiple defendants. Finding the evidence sufficient and no reversible error, we affirm.

On appeal from a criminal conviction, the evidence must be viewed in the light most favorable to the verdict, and the presumption of innocence no longer lies in favor of the defendant. Newman v. State, 233 Ga. App. 794 1 504 SE2d 476 1998. So viewed, the evidence shows that on May 26, 2001, at approximately 11 p.m., Turner and co-defendant, James Dewayne Clark, arrived at the locked entrance to the Ameri-Host Inn outside Stockbridge, Georgia. On-duty desk clerk, Nazeline Jean, met the pair at the door. Jean let them in and led them to the front desk after Clark asked if there were any vacancies. On reaching the front desk, Clark pulled a knife on Jean, ordered her to hand over the money in the cash register, and threatened to harm her if she screamed, also indicating that he had a gun in addition to the knife. After Jean emptied the first of two cash drawers, Clark gave the knife to Turner and went into an office adjoining the front desk. Turner now holding the knife on her, Jean emptied the second cash drawer. Turner took the money. She and Clark then ordered Jean into the office. There Turner bound Jean’s hands with a telephone cord and stuffed a towel into her mouth. Turner and Clark then picked up the safe in the office and left the hotel carrying it. Held:
